As of Oct '25, Realtor.com reports that the median days on market for a home in Oak Park, IL is 28. This is a decrease of -34.0% from last year, suggesting that homes are sitting on the market shorter than last year. The percentage of listed homes with a reduced price is 33.0%, representing a large inventory and a lot of supply pressure on home prices.

Demographics — Oak Park, IL

As of the latest ACS Survey released in 2023, Oak Park, IL has a population of 3,510, which has increased by 38.3% over the past 5 years. Oak Park, IL is a less popular place for families, as children make up 10.1% of the population. The area has a highly educated workforce, with 79.0% of adult residents holding a bachelor’s degree or higher. There are many residents working remotely, with 29.8% reporting working from home.

As of the latest ACS Survey released in 2023, Oak Park, IL is a predominantly white area, with 57.3% of the population identifying as white. The white population has grown by 10.0% in the last 5 years. The second most common race or ethnicity in Oak Park, IL is black, making up 15.9% of the population. Foreign-born residents account for 14.4% of the population in Oak Park, IL, and this percentage has decreased by 21.3% as of the ACS Survey 5 years prior, suggesting fewer immigrants are calling the area home.

Mortgage and Risk — Oak Park, IL

According to HUD data as of 2023, there were 65 mortgage originations in Oak Park, IL, of which 98.0% of loans were conventional mortgages. The average loan-to-value was 68.0%, with 26.0% above 90% LTV (very high). This implies large mortgage risk in Oak Park, IL. Investor activity is low, as 0.0% of loans were by investors. 5.0% of loans were cash-out refinances, suggesting few homeowners are tapping equity.
